MyUS.com - Shopping Experience

I got an AMEX Gold Card some time back and they are tied up with MyUS.com, using which you can buy things from USA and Ship them to India. Here is my experience.

I bought Skechers Shoes from www.shoes.com, the shoes cost 50 USD. The membership fee is waved off for 1st year for AMEX customers. MyUS.com has a good personal shopper where you can just put the details of the product you want to buy and pay for it, they will do the rest, but they charge a fee ($10 + Any USA shipping fee), for me it came to 20 USD. So total of 70 USD.

The package arrived at their FLORIDA Address. As soon as it arrived, I received an email from MyUS.com for my permission to ship it. The shipping cost after 20% discount was 40 USD. So the total came to 110 USD.

I checked the Indian Customs website and it said that anything below Rs 5000 (=100 USD) is free and will not be charged, but when the package arrived, I was shocked, that it asked me to pay, 1200 as custom charges (approx 25 USD), that's almost 60% of the shoe price, I have no idea why so much of custom charges.

So the total cost of 50 USD shoe came to

50 + 20 + 40 + 25 = 135 USD, more than twice the cost of the product !!!!

PROS (MyUS.com) -

1. Excellent communication through Emails.
2. Clarity on charges.
3. Good Package.
4. Through AMEX, discounts are available.

CONS (MyUS.com)

1. They don't mark the product as GIFT.
2. There is no calculation of custom or an estimate on how much it will cost.

FINAL words

There are other websites which include everything, including the customs etc, like www.shopyourworld.com, ebay.in (Global Shipping Program) and they are good, I have bought earlier from them. I thought, MyUS.com would be cheaper, but it turned out to me at least 20 - 30 USD more expensive. One should one use it, if you are getting some Deal, like the product is on 80% discount or something, otherwise use www.shopyourworld.com or Ebay.in or similar websites.
